Design of the TCV tokamak

Description

Various studies have shown that a significant improvement in tokamak performance can be obtained by elongating and shaping the cross section of the plasma ring. Plasmas with high elongation are however strongly unstable to the vertical axisymmetric mode and their control is a major problem. The objective of TCV (Tokamak a Configuration Variable Ro=0.88 m, a=0.24 m, b/a up to 3, Btor=1.43 T, Iplasma up to 1.2 MA) presently under construction at the CRPP is to study scenarios for the creation of such plasmas and to evaluate the improvements in plasma parameters such as the maximum plasma current and density, the confinement time and the maximum pressure that can be sustained.
